What is Forage Drought Recovery Planting Schedule?

The Forage Drought Recovery Planting Schedule is a specialized template designed to assist agricultural professionals in planning and executing forage planting after a drought. This template provides a structured approach to assess soil conditions, select appropriate forage crops, and implement effective planting strategies. Drought conditions can severely impact forage availability, leading to challenges in livestock feeding and soil health. By using this schedule, farmers can systematically recover their forage production, ensuring sustainable agricultural practices. For example, the template includes steps for soil testing, which is critical in determining nutrient deficiencies caused by drought stress. Additionally, it incorporates timelines for planting drought-resistant forage species, ensuring optimal growth and yield.

Why use this Forage Drought Recovery Planting Schedule?

Drought conditions pose unique challenges, such as soil degradation, reduced forage availability, and increased costs for livestock feed. The Forage Drought Recovery Planting Schedule addresses these pain points by offering a comprehensive plan tailored to post-drought scenarios. For example, the template includes guidelines for selecting drought-tolerant forage species, which can thrive in low-moisture conditions. It also provides a step-by-step process for implementing irrigation systems that optimize water usage, crucial in areas with limited water resources. By following this schedule, users can mitigate the risks associated with drought recovery, such as poor crop yields and financial losses, while promoting sustainable farming practices.
